All About En-Bloc Capsulectomy



We learn about different surgeries and today, we are here to explain about one such complex surgery that people undergo. It is En-bloc capsulectomy. It is different from regular capsulectomy. En-bloc capsulectomy is the complete removal of the scar tissue surrounding a breast implant but it happens in one complete piece. The surgery is about breast implant removal while it is still encased in the entire scar tissue capsule that surrounds it. The term En-bloc means ‘altogether.’ 

Many surgeons remove the capsule in pieces and others might leave a significant portion of capsules in the breast pocket. Neither of the techniques can match the precision of an en bloc procedure. The difficult for the patient is that he or she will never know what kind of capsulectomy is being performed on them, even if the surgeon claims to perform an en bloc capsulectomy. 

The procedure is complex and it requires a great deal of precision on the part of the surgeon to perform the surgery successfully.
